Description and conversion results of color RAL D2 120 90 30

It is a bright pastel chartreuse green color having an approximate luminance of 90%. It has a hue value of 80° indicating that this is a cold color.

Conversion results

The following list contains the conversion results of color RAL D2 120 90 30 to rgb, hexadecimal, hsl, hsv, lab and xyz colorspaces. Each format represents the same color.

rgb (215, 234, 176) #d7eab0 hsl (79.7, 58%, 80.4%) hsv (79.7, 24.8%, 91.8%) lab (90.1, -16, 26.1) xyz (65.3, 76.4, 52.4)

Color schemes and palettes

Color schemes represent a set of colors creating a harmonic and aesthetic feeling. Color schemes are generated by choosing colors around the color wheel.

We can talk about monochromatic, complementary, triadic and tetradic color schemes, choosing one, two, three or four colors around the color wheel respectively.
